Anybody who bought an Xbox before the 26th March will know that they're entitled to a load of free stuff. They should know that before this date, Microsoft just wanted you to fill in the form and send it by post. And after this date, they required proof of purchase. After numerous e-mails to the (admittedly, well responding) Xbox customer care, I found that since I sent mine before the 26th March I won't need to send by post proof of purchase.

And here I am, a week over the '29 days' delivery time, and still nothing. So I called Microsoft.

And here's the juice of the matter:

Microsoft had a 'system failure' which resulted in all of the application forms sent before the 26th April to be deleted. Convenient. They haven't contacted anybody about it, which means that if I'd have just waited, the offer would have expired and I'd have been conned out of more stuff from Microsoft.

So anybody who hasn't yet sent proof of purchase, you need to. Send the new form off again by post and hopefully you'll get the stuff.
